Clinical Views
What are Clinical Views?
- Goal: To give staff an easy way of finding condition-relevant or program-relevant information.
- Why: Clinicians often have a focus-area they are interested in, e.g. a clinician in an HIV Outpatient clinic has specific information, labs, medications etc that they are most interested in reviewing.
- I want a set of pages that have widgets on them related to a particular clinical scenario, so that it's easier for me to find the information I need for a particular care issue for a patient.
Examples:
- HIV Adult Care
- Summary/ overview page with HIV-relevant information (e.g. ART start date)
- Lab page with HIV-relevant labs
- NCD View
How can Clinical Views be set up / configured?
Vision: Ability to use configuration to define your clinical views (the view name, page names, and which extensions in what order)
